There is a rule on Udemy platform that once a course goes live, you cannot change its URL. For example if you choose your course name to be The A Technology Deep Dive, the URL will be like udemy.com/the-a-technology-deep-dive and it cannot be changed later. Given that some instructors prefer to maintain a course and overhaul it for a long time, and even maybe reorganize it in a way that it can be called with a different name, it would be good to be able to choose a different URL than what you chose years ago, reflecting the name you currently use for the course. The Udemy platform can still keep referring the old URL clicked by some users to the same course, while also allowing a new more relevant URL to be used. Dear Udemy, could you please kindly consider supporting this feature? You can add some restriction though, e.g. "You cannot change course URL more than twice in 6 months", or something like that.
